Our NFHS Network cameras were installed today at both the RRHS Gym and Hoyle Field. RRGSD will be joining other schools in the Northern Carolina Athletic Conference and across the state offering both live stream and on demand video of athletic events. RRHS will begin with volleyball, basketball, soccer, football, and wrestling with hopes of expanding to other events in future years. Are you missing out? Even though our meals are free though the end of the school year, parents are being encouraged to apply online. Why apply for meal benefits when meals are already free? Meal benefits can: Qualify students for P-EBT Waive the cost of ACT, SAT, AP and other tests Provide discounts for college application process Support funding or discounts for internet access Impact allotments of funds for certain programs Sign up online: https://www.lunchapplication.com/
